#bb9be5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bb9be5 is composed of 73.3% red, 60.8%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 32.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 265.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 75.3%. #bb9be5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7737cb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#bb9be5 color description : Very soft violet.
The hexadecimal color #bb9be5 has RGB values of R:187, G:155,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 12295141.
